Abstract
In this paper, by using elementary analysis, we establish several new Lyapunov type inequalities for the following nonlinear dynamic system on an arbitrary time scale TT{xΔ(t)=α(t)x(σ(t))+β(t)|y(t)|p−2y(t),yΔ(t)=−γ(t)|x(σ(t))|q−2x(σ(t))−α(t)y(t), when the end-points are not necessarily usual zeros, but rather, generalized zeros, which generalize and improve all related existing ones including the continuous and discrete cases.
